    AKG C414XLII/ST is a matched pair of multi-pattern large-diaphragm condenser microphones complete with accessories and hard case.

    Realistic stereo recordings require microphones with outstanding performance and excellent quality. They also require performance consistency and accurate localisation from the pair of microphones.

    Therefore, every factory-matched pair has been created from thousands of individual microphones selected by AKG's sophisticated computer-aided matching method. The result is the highest possible correlation over the whole frequency range and virtually identical sensitivity for stunning, three-dimensional recordings.

    The matched pairs consist of two microphones that are within 1 dB to each other in sensitivity and also within 1 dB to each other in the range of 300 Hz to 8,000 Hz of the individual frequency response when used in cardioid mode. The microphones are selected from a large quantity of individual microphones according to the described criteria by using a proprietary computer program.

    Using this matched pair for stereo recordings in various techniques will provide a good and stable balance without frequency-dependent shifting of the stereo panorama.

    The new models C 414 XLS and C 414 XLII offer nine pickup patterns which enable to choose the perfect setting for every application. For live-sound applications and permanent installations all controls can be disabled easily for trouble-free use. A Peak Hold LED displays even shortest overload peaks.

    The C 414 comes complete with carrying case, pop filter, windscreen, and spider-type shock mount.

    Features

    • Polar pattern  Omnidirectional, wide cardioid, cardioid, hyper-cardioid, figure eight and 4 intermediate settings
    • Frequency range  20 to 20,000 Hz
    • Sensitivity  20 mV/Pa (-34 dBV) ± 0.5 dB
    • Max. SPL  200/400/800/1600 Pa = 140/146/152/158 dB (0/-6/-12/-18 dB) for 0.5% THD
    • Equivalent noise level  6 dB-A (0 dB pre-attenuation) (IEC 60268-4)
    • Signal/noise ratio (A-weighted)  88 dB
    • Pre-attenuation pad  0 dB, -6 dB, -12 dB, -18 dB, switchable
    • Bass cut filter slope  12 dB/octave at 40 Hz and 80 Hz; 6 dB/octave at 160 Hz
    • Impedance  <=200 ohms
    • Recommended load impedance  >= 2,200 ohms
    • Supply voltage  48 V phantom power to DIN/IEC
    • Powering  approximately 4 mA
    • Connector  3-pin XLR to IEC
    • Finish  dark grey/gold
    • Dimensions  50 x 38 x 160 mm (2.0 x 1.5 x 6.3 in.)
    • Net weight  300 g (10.6 oz.)
